Travel Score in 12057, Eagle Bridge, New York

The Travel Score for the Lung Cancer Score in 12057, Eagle Bridge, New York is 37 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

44.83 percent of residents in 12057 to travel to work in 30 minutes or less.

When looking at the three closest hospitals, the average distance to a hospital is 23.36 miles. The closest hospital with an emergency room is Samaritan Hospital Of Troy, New York with a distance of 22.82 miles from the area.

## Lung Cancer Score: Navigating Healthcare in Eagle Bridge, NY (ZIP Code 12057)

Considering a move to the charming village of Eagle Bridge, New York (ZIP Code 12057)? Nestled amidst the rolling hills of Rensselaer County, this community offers a tranquil escape. However, before packing your bags, prospective residents, particularly those with a history of smoking or a family history of lung cancer, should carefully consider healthcare access. This analysis provides a "Lung Cancer Score" for Eagle Bridge, focusing on transportation options and the potential challenges of accessing specialized medical care, crucial for early detection and treatment.

The Lung Cancer Score is not a formal medical assessment. Instead, it's a qualitative evaluation of the practical hurdles individuals might face in receiving timely and appropriate lung cancer care, given their location and the available **transportation** infrastructure. It considers factors like drive times, public transit options, and the availability of ride-sharing and medical **transport** services. A lower score suggests easier access, while a higher score indicates potential difficulties.

Eagle Bridge, a small, rural community, presents unique **healthcare access** challenges. The nearest hospitals with comprehensive oncology services are in Troy and Albany, New York. This necessitates careful planning, especially for those requiring frequent appointments for diagnosis, treatment (chemotherapy, radiation), and follow-up care.

**Drive Times and Roadways: The Foundation of Access**

The primary mode of **transportation** for most Eagle Bridge residents is personal vehicles. The journey to Albany Medical Center, a major regional healthcare provider, typically involves a drive of approximately 45 to 60 minutes, depending on traffic. This route primarily utilizes New York State Route 67, a two-lane road that winds through picturesque landscapes. During peak hours, traffic congestion can occur, adding to the travel time.

Alternatively, residents can travel to Samaritan Hospital in Troy, a closer option, taking around 30 to 45 minutes. This route also primarily utilizes Route 67, with potential for delays. For those seeking specialized care at the Dana-Farber Cancer Institute in Boston, a significantly longer drive of approximately three hours is required, primarily via Interstate 90 (the New York State Thruway) and the Massachusetts Turnpike.

The condition of the roadways, especially during winter months, can significantly impact travel times and safety. Snow and ice can make Route 67 treacherous, potentially delaying or even preventing access to critical medical appointments. This highlights the importance of reliable vehicle maintenance and preparedness for adverse weather conditions.

**Public Transit: A Limited Option**

Public **transport** options in Eagle Bridge are extremely limited. The Capital District Transportation Authority (CDTA) provides bus service in the greater Albany area, but routes rarely extend to Eagle Bridge. The availability of public **transport** for individuals with lung cancer, who may experience fatigue or mobility limitations, is severely restricted.

While CDTA offers some ADA-accessible buses, the infrequent service and long travel times make public **transport** a less viable option for regular medical appointments. This lack of reliable public **transport** significantly increases the Lung Cancer Score for Eagle Bridge residents.

**Ride-Sharing and Medical Transport: Filling the Gaps**

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ft are available in the Albany area, but their presence in Eagle Bridge is less consistent. Availability may be limited, especially during off-peak hours or in inclement weather. Relying on ride-sharing for frequent medical appointments could prove costly and unreliable.

Medical **transport** services, such as those offered by private ambulance companies, are an option for individuals with mobility limitations or those requiring specialized assistance. These services can provide door-to-door **transport** to medical appointments. However, they often come with a significant cost, and availability may be limited, requiring advance booking.

**The Lung Cancer Score for Eagle Bridge (ZIP Code 12057): A Summary**

Considering the factors discussed, the Lung Cancer Score for Eagle Bridge is relatively high. The reliance on personal vehicles, the limited public **transport** options, and the potential challenges associated with ride-sharing and medical **transport** services contribute to this score.
